titleOfInvention | Photochromic Diarylethene-based Compounds and Method for Preparing the Same |
abstract | In the present disclosure, it is possible to easily reversibly form a ring-closure structure and a ring-opening structure in response to irradiation with ultraviolet rays, and various photochromisms are made by using a substituent attached to an ethyne moiety, which is a bridging unit in a photochromic diarylethene compound. Provided are photochromic diarylethene-based compounds useful as monomers for preparing polymers and capable of selective reaction designs, and methods for their preparation. |
